Granite Falls is listed in the Waterfalls Category for Snohomish County in the state of Washington. Granite Falls is displayed on the "Granite Falls" USGS topo map. The latitude and longitude coordinates (GPS waypoint) of Granite Falls are 48.102879 (North), -121.9534645 (West) and the approximate elevation is 295 feet (90 meters) above sea level.
